Roundtable: Day One Bounce Survival Guide — Demoitis, Mixbus, & Vocals
In this episode of Producer Points, we're digging into one of the most stressful — and most important — moments in a producer’s workflow: the Day One bounce.
That first export gets sent to artists, managers, and labels. It sets the tone, shapes opinions, and might even determine whether the song survives. It might not be the final version, but it feels final to everyone else. And once someone gets attached to a demo… good luck changing it.
From dealing with demoitis to deciding whether to send a polished bounce or just a topline over chords, we break it all down with three incredibly insightful producers who’ve lived it.
